Table 1

Clinical characteristics of children’s COVID-19 cases (N=30)

CharacteristicsValue
Age, mean (SD), years9.2 (5.2)
Age group, n (%)
 1 month to <1 year1 (3)
 1–4 years5 (17)
 5–9 years9 (30)
 10–14 years10 (33)
 15–17 years4 (13)
Girls, n (%)13 (43)
Boys, n (%)17 (57)
Vaccination, n (%)
 Seasonal influenza4 (13)
 BCG30 (100)
 MMR29 (97)
Total baseline chronic medical conditions, n (%)7 (23)
 Bronchial asthma3 (10)
 Congenital heart disease2 (7)
 Attention deficit disorder1 (3)
 Epilepsy1 (3)
Immunosuppressant use before presentation, n (%)1 (3)
Acute COVID-19 symptoms, n (%)
Fever, n (%)
 ≥37.5°C–38°C5 (17)
 38.1°C–39.0°C4 (13)
 >39.0°C5 (17)
 Rhinorrhoea8 (27)
 Cough7 (23)
 Fatigue7 (23)
 Headache7 (23)
 Stuffy nose7 (23)
 Sneezing6 (20)
 Sore throat6 (20)
 Diarrhoea4 (13)
 Anosmia3 (10)
 Ageusia2 (7)
 Poor appetite2 (7)
 Myalgia1 (3)
 Shortness of breath1 (3)
 Conjunctivitis1 (3)
 Ear pain1 (3)
 Vomiting1 (3)
Severity of illness, n (%)
 Asymptomatic5 (17)
 Mild24 (80)
 Moderate1 (3)
